Trench installation services involve the process of digging narrow, linear excavations into the ground to facilitate the placement of utilities, drainage systems, or other infrastructure. These trenches are carefully excavated to ensure proper depth, width, and alignment according to project specifications. The work often requires specialized equipment and skilled operators to navigate around existing underground utilities and prevent damage to surrounding structures. Once the trench is excavated, it provides a protected pathway for pipes, cables, or conduits to be laid securely underground.
This service addresses common issues such as improper drainage, utility conflicts, or the need for underground wiring. Proper trench installation helps prevent water accumulation, soil erosion, and structural damage caused by poorly managed drainage systems. It also ensures that utility lines are safely and efficiently routed, reducing the risk of future disruptions or costly repairs. Trench installation can be a critical component in both new construction projects and upgrades to existing properties, providing a reliable foundation for essential infrastructure.

The overview below groups typical Trench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Charlotte,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Labor Costs - Trench installation labor typically ranges from $45 to $85 per hour per worker. Total costs depend on project size and complexity, with a standard trench costing around $500 to $2,000 in labor fees.
Material Expenses - The cost of materials such as pipes, gravel, and backfill can vary from $10 to $50 per linear foot. For example, a 50-foot trench may require $500 to $2,500 worth of materials.
Equipment Fees - Equipment rental or usage fees for trenching machines and related tools generally fall between $200 and $1,000 per project. Larger or more complex projects may incur higher equipment costs.
Additional Charges - Permitting, site preparation, and disposal fees can add $200 to $1,000 or more. These costs depend on local regulations and site conditions in Charlotte, NC, and surrounding areas.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
